X-Git-Url: http://source.bookstackapp.com/bookstack/blobdiff_plain/9eb65dcd78df535f0b0e61cde8005623a6d91a61..refs/pull/3138/head:/app/Http/Controllers/Auth/MfaBackupCodesController.php diff --git a/app/Http/Controllers/Auth/MfaBackupCodesController.php b/app/Http/Controllers/Auth/MfaBackupCodesController.php index c60dbca20..e24090022 100644 --- a/app/Http/Controllers/Auth/MfaBackupCodesController.php +++ b/app/Http/Controllers/Auth/MfaBackupCodesController.php @@ -53,6 +53,7 @@ class MfaBackupCodesController extends Controller if (!auth()->check()) { $this->showSuccessNotification(trans('auth.mfa_setup_login_notification')); + return redirect('/login'); } @@ -72,8 +73,7 @@ class MfaBackupCodesController extends Controller $this->validate($request, [ 'code' => [ - 'required', - 'max:12', 'min:8', + 'required', 'max:12', 'min:8', function ($attribute, $value, $fail) use ($codeService, $codes) { if (!$codeService->inputCodeExistsInSet($value, $codes)) { $fail(trans('validation.backup_codes'));